Python基礎篇(流程控制)
流程控制是程序運行的基礎,流程控制決定了程序按照什么樣的方式執行。
條件語句
條件語句一般用來判斷給定的條件是否成立,根據結果來執行不同的代碼,也就是說,有了條件語句,才可以根據不同的情況做不同的事,從而控制程序的流程。
if else
if 條件成立,執行 if 內的命令;否則條件不成立,則執行else內的命令。
例如:
if elif elif else
if elif elif else
當出現if ...else ... 無法解決的情況時,我們就需要使用 if...elif...elif...else 來處理。
例如:

循環語句
程序中常常需要重復執行某些語句,我們總不可能重復寫多變吧。所以在python中,有一種語句可以重復執行相同的操作,這種語句就是 “循環語句”,而被重復執行的一組語句稱為 “循環體”。在python中有兩種循環語句,分別是while循環語句 和 for 循環語句。
while 循環
while 語句用于循環執行程序,即在某條件下,循環執行某段程序,以處理需要重復處理的相同任務。
例如:

for 循環
for 循環用于遍歷任何序列的項目,也可以用來遍歷字符串、列表、元組、字典等等。
例如:

循環控制
循環控制
在某些情況下,我們需要根據實際情況來終止循環或者跳過某次循環,所以就產生了循環控制語句。
python中控制循環的語句有兩種:break(終止循環) 和 continue(跳出本次循環去執行下一次)。
例如:



浙公網安備 33010602011771號